OTA datagram

The OTA Datagram is a time-varying spectral representation that shows how the
power of a signal varies with time. The power allocated to the specific resource block
will be represented with an amplitude axis (in dBm) and the waterfall diagram will
show the trend of past resource block power over certain period. Using a marker
function facilitates analysis of accumulated resource block power for data utilization.
